Pros

- work is easy, don't have to use your brain for anything - convenient location in Old City Philadelphia - great pay for someone just leaving high school or college - Great way to think about landing a job in being a Federal Government employee

Cons

- Accrue 1.54 per week (3.08 per paycheck), use this for both Sick and Vacation. If you do not have PTO you have to use Leave Without Pay (LWOP) and you can only use 40 hours of LWOP before they fire you. (Seen this multiple times) - Managers and Supervisors treat CGI workers like garbage like this is still slavery days but yet bow down to government workers. - Little to no room of growth - Revolving door of employees - Some of the people who work for CGI are uncoof, unprofessional, ghetto, and say anything out their mouth. - I would runaway or keep on searching if someone needs a job.
